Kiel is a port city on Germany's Baltic Sea coast. Much of the city center it was obliterated during WWII by bombing raids on its U-boat pens. In the old town, the rebuilt, medieval St. Nikolai Church hosts classical concerts and Holstenstrasse and Danische Strasse are streets lined with shops. The city also has several indoor malls linked by pedestrian bridges. Along the Kiel Fjord, the Maritime Museum displays model ships and nautical instruments in a former fish auction hall. Nearby, cruise ships dock at the Ostseekai Terminal in Germania Harbor. This grand harbor in Kiel continues on as it has for centuries and should be the focus of your visit. Huge ferries transport millions of passengers to and from Scandinavia, while summer sees locals strolling the long waterfront promenade.
Brno is a city in the Czech Republic known for its modernist and baroque buildings, gardens, museums, and churches. There are many monuments and cultural features especially related to the city's Moravian history, like the Moravian Museum and Moravian Gallery. It is also uniquely located between a landscape of South Moravian Vineyards and northern Moravian Karst topography.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Kiel is €138, while the average daily cost in Brno is €122.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. Both destinations experience a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. And since both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.
Both Brno and Kiel are popular destinations to visit in the summer with plenty of activities. Many visitors come to Kiel in the summer for the beaches, the city activities, and the family-friendly experiences.
Kiel is cooler than Brno in the summer. The daily temperature in Kiel averages around 16°C (61°F) in July, and Brno fluctuates around 23°C (73°F).
It's quite sunny in Brno. The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Kiel. Kiel usually receives less sunshine than Brno during summer. Kiel gets 219 hours of sunny skies, while Brno receives 236 hours of full sun in the summer.
In July, Kiel usually receives more rain than Brno. Kiel gets 88 mm (3.4 in) of rain, while Brno receives 69 mm (2.7 in) of rain each month for the summer.
Both Brno and Kiel during the autumn are popular places to visit. Most visitors come to Kiel for the city's sights and attractions and the shopping scene during these months.
In the autumn, Kiel is cooler than Brno. Typically, the autumn temperatures in Kiel in October average around 10°C (50°F), and Brno averages at about 12°C (54°F).
In the autumn, Kiel often gets less sunshine than Brno. Kiel gets 102 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Brno receives 129 hours of full sun.
Kiel usually gets more rain in October than Brno. Kiel gets 65 mm (2.6 in) of rain, while Brno receives 35 mm (1.4 in) of rain this time of the year.
The winter attracts plenty of travelers to both Kiel and Brno. The winter months attract visitors to Kiel because of the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ine.
It's quite cold in Brno in the winter. The weather in Kiel can be very cold. In January, Kiel is generally much colder than Brno. Daily temperatures in Kiel average around 0°C (33°F), and Brno fluctuates around 2°C (36°F).
Kiel usually receives less sunshine than Brno during winter. Kiel gets 39 hours of sunny skies, while Brno receives 49 hours of full sun in the winter.
In January, Kiel usually receives more rain than Brno. Kiel gets 61 mm (2.4 in) of rain, while Brno receives 25 mm (1 in) of rain each month for the winter.
The spring brings many poeple to Kiel as well as Brno. The beaches and the activities around the city are the main draw to Kiel this time of year.
Kiel is much colder than Brno in the spring. The daily temperature in Kiel averages around 7°C (44°F) in April, and Brno fluctuates around 13°C (55°F).
In the spring, Kiel often gets around the same amount of sunshine as Brno. Kiel gets 171 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Brno receives 167 hours of full sun.
Kiel usually gets more rain in April than Brno. Kiel gets 49 mm (1.9 in) of rain, while Brno receives 32 mm (1.3 in) of rain this time of the year.
Kiel | Brno |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| |
Jan | 0°C (33°F) | 61 mm (2.4 in) | 2°C (36°F) | 25 mm (1 in) |
Feb | 1°C (34°F) | 37 mm (1.5 in) | 4°C (38°F) | 23 mm (0.9 in) |
Mar | 3°C (38°F) | 47 mm (1.9 in) | 8°C (46°F) | 25 mm (1 in) |
Apr | 7°C (44°F) | 49 mm (1.9 in) | 13°C (55°F) | 32 mm (1.3 in) |
May | 11°C (53°F) | 53 mm (2.1 in) | 17°C (63°F) | 61 mm (2.4 in) |
Jun | 15°C (59°F) | 65 mm (2.6 in) | 20°C (69°F) | 70 mm (2.8 in) |
Jul | 16°C (61°F) | 88 mm (3.4 in) | 23°C (73°F) | 69 mm (2.7 in) |
Aug | 16°C (62°F) | 71 mm (2.8 in) | 22°C (72°F) | 58 mm (2.3 in) |
Sep | 14°C (56°F) | 64 mm (2.5 in) | 18°C (64°F) | 34 mm (1.3 in) |
Oct | 10°C (50°F) | 65 mm (2.6 in) | 12°C (54°F) | 35 mm (1.4 in) |
Nov | 5°C (41°F) | 82 mm (3.2 in) | 7°C (45°F) | 40 mm (1.6 in) |
Dec | 2°C (35°F) | 73 mm (2.9 in) | 3°C (37°F) | 25 mm (1 in) |
